1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a summary?
Back
A short explanation of a text.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How should you write your summary?
Back
In your own words with complete sentences.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the first step to summarizing a passage?
Back
Carefully reading through and understanding the passage so you can make a better summary.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which best describes a summary?
Back
The main ideas and important details of a text.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Why is it important to summarize?
Back
It helps you understand and remember the main points of a text.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What should you include in a summary?
Back
The main ideas and key details from the original text.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the difference between a summary and a paraphrase?
Back
A summary condenses the main ideas, while a paraphrase rewrites the text in your own words.
